What Unique Varietals of Sparkling Wine Can You Discover at Trader Joe’s?
At Trader Joe’s, you can find some unique varietals of sparkling wine that cater to various tastes and preferences.
- Brut Rosé: This sparkling wine typically features a blend of Pinot Noir and Chardonnay, offering a delightful balance of fruity and floral notes. Its crisp acidity makes it an excellent choice for celebrations or pairing with light appetizers.
- Cava: Originating from Spain, Cava is made using traditional methods and is often crafted from indigenous grape varieties like Macabeo, Xarel-lo, and Parellada. It presents a refreshing profile with citrus and green apple flavors, making it a versatile option for any occasion.
- Prosecco: This Italian sparkling wine is known for its fruity and floral characteristics, primarily derived from the Glera grape. Prosecco tends to be lighter and less yeasty than traditional Champagne, making it a popular choice for brunch or casual gatherings.
- French Crémant: Crémant is a sparkling wine made outside of the Champagne region in France, using the same traditional methods. It can be produced from various grape varieties depending on the region, resulting in a wide range of flavors, from rich and creamy to crisp and refreshing.
- California Sparkling Wine: Trader Joe’s offers several options from California, where many wineries produce high-quality sparkling wines using the traditional méthode champenoise. These wines often showcase fruit-forward profiles with rich textures, reflecting the unique terroir of the region.
- Lambrusco: While not a traditional sparkling wine, Lambrusco is a lightly sparkling red wine from Italy that is gaining popularity. Known for its fruity and slightly sweet taste, it pairs wonderfully with a variety of foods, making it an interesting choice for those looking for something different.
What Key Features Should You Look for When Choosing Sparkling Wines at Trader Joe’s?
When choosing sparkling wines at Trader Joe’s, consider the following key features:
- Origin: The region where the wine is produced can greatly influence its flavor profile and quality.
- Grape Variety: Different grape varieties contribute unique characteristics to sparkling wines, affecting taste and aroma.
- Sweetness Level: Understanding the sweetness level of sparkling wines is essential to match them with your palate and food pairings.
- Carbonation Type: The method of carbonation can affect the texture and mouthfeel of the wine.
- Price Point: Evaluating the price in relation to quality can help you find the best value for your purchase.
Origin: The origin of sparkling wine, such as Champagne, Prosecco, or Cava, is crucial since it often dictates the style and quality. For example, Champagne from France is known for its complexity and finesse, while Prosecco from Italy tends to be more fruity and light. Each region has its regulations and traditions that influence the final product.
Grape Variety: Sparkling wines can be made from various grape varieties like Chardonnay, Pinot Noir, and Trebbiano, each imparting distinct flavors. For instance, Chardonnay adds elegance and structure, while Pinot Noir brings fruitiness and body. Knowing the grape varieties can help you select a wine that aligns with your taste preferences.
Sweetness Level: Sparkling wines can range from dry (Brut) to sweet (Demi-Sec), affecting how well they pair with different foods. Understanding whether you prefer a crisp, dry sparkling wine or a sweeter option can enhance your enjoyment and make your selection process more straightforward. Labels often indicate sweetness levels, so look for terms like Brut Nature or Extra Dry.
Carbonation Type: Sparkling wines can be carbonated through methods like traditional méthode champenoise or tank fermentation, impacting their texture. The traditional method creates fine bubbles and a creamy mouthfeel, while tank fermentation often results in coarser bubbles. This choice can significantly influence your drinking experience, so consider what texture you enjoy.
Price Point: Trader Joe’s offers a range of sparkling wines at various price points, so it’s important to balance quality with cost. Higher-priced options might come from renowned regions or producers, while lower-priced wines can still provide excellent quality. Assessing the price alongside the wine’s characteristics can help you find a great bottle that fits your budget.
What Are the Best Food Pairings for Sparkling Wines from Trader Joe’s?
The best food pairings for sparkling wines from Trader Joe’s can enhance your tasting experience significantly.
- Seafood: Sparkling wines, especially those with high acidity like Champagne or Prosecco, pair exceptionally well with seafood dishes. The bubbles help cut through the richness of dishes like fried calamari or creamy seafood pastas, while the acidity complements the freshness of raw oysters or ceviche.
- Charcuterie and Cheese: A variety of sparkling wines can elevate a charcuterie board or cheese platter. The effervescence of the wine cleanses the palate between bites of rich meats and creamy cheeses, making it an ideal match for items such as prosciutto, aged cheddar, or a tangy blue cheese.
- Spicy Dishes: Sparkling wines can serve as a wonderful counterbalance to spicy foods. The sweetness and bubbles can temper the heat of dishes like spicy Asian cuisine or Mexican fare, allowing the flavors to shine without overwhelming the palate.
- Fried Foods: The crispness of sparkling wines makes them a perfect companion for fried foods. Whether it’s crispy tempura, fried chicken, or doughnuts, the bubbles help to cleanse the oiliness, enhancing the overall enjoyment of the meal.
- Fruit-Based Desserts: Sweet sparkling wines pair beautifully with fruit-based desserts, such as tarts or sorbets. The wine’s natural sweetness complements the fruity flavors while the acidity balances the dish, making it a refreshing conclusion to a meal.
